Paul Dini, co-creator of Harley Quinn and longtime writer/producer on Batman: The Animated Series, will hold an event in support of his recent graphic novel Harley Quinn: A Celebration of 25 Years at Barnes & Noble in Los Angeles next month.

The event will celebrate Harley’s “takeover” of DC’s annual Batman Day event, which in turn recognizes the 25th anniversary of Harley’s first appearance on TV.
Attending fans can also take home plenty of free giveaways including three new comic books:
- BATMAN DAY 2017 SPECIAL EDITION #1 includes the first chapter of BATMAN VOL. 3: I AM BANE written by Tom King and illustrated by David Finch, plus an original 3-page story by Amanda Conner, Jimmy Palmiotti and Bret Blevins.
- HARLEY QUINN BATMAN DAY 2017 SPECIAL EDITION #1 features the first chapter of the JOKER LOVES HARLEY graphic novel by Amanda Conner, Jimmy Palmiotti and John Timms.
- DC SUPER HERO GIRLS BATMAN DAY 2017 SPECIAL EDITION #1, a sneak preview of the upcoming all-ages original graphic novel, DC SUPER HERO GIRLS: OUT OF THE BOTTLE written by Shea Fontana with art by Marcelo DiChiara and Agnes Garbowska.
The event takes place on September 23 at 5 p.m. at Barnes & Noble on the Grove. A wristband is required to attend this event and will be issued on a first come, first serve basis to those who purchase Harley Quinn: A Celebration of 25 Years from Barnes & Noble at The Grove beginning that morning at 9am.
Fans are limited to one wristband per book purchase and may bring two additional items from home to be signed by Dini.
You can see the official synopsis for the book below.
From her animated adventures to her bloody stint in the Suicide Squad, HARLEY QUINN: A CELEBRATION OF 25 YEARS captures the greatest comic book moments of the Joker’s main moll, brought to life by industry legends Paul Dini, Bruce Timm, Jim Lee, Jeph Loeb, Amanda Conner, Jimmy Palmiotti, Karl Kesel, Terry Dodson and more!
The true embodiment of the phrase “madly in love,” Harley Quinn may be stark, raving, cuckoo-pants crazy, but she is a woman who stands by her man. Filled with an inexplicable devotion to Batman’s nemesis, the Joker, she’s the Clown Prince of Crime’s most loyal companion.
But while her monstrous “Mistah J” may have led her to a life of crime, he also brought her comic book superstardom! It’s been 25 years since she made her debut, but Harley Quinn’s popularity continues to grow, spreading from animation to comic books to video games to live-action feature films, with no sign of slowing down.
Collects BATMAN ADVENTURES ANNUAL #1; BATMAN ADVENTURES HOLIDAY SPECIAL #1; BATGIRL ADVENTURES #1; BATMAN ADVENTURES #3; BATMAN ADVENTURES #16; BATMAN/HARLEY QUINN #1; HARLEY QUINN #1, #25; HARLEY AND IVY: LOVE ON THE LAM; BATMAN #613; JOKER’S ASYLUM II: HARLEY QUINN #1; SUICIDE SQUAD (vol. 3) #6-7; HARLEY QUINN (vol. 2) #2; HARLEY’S LITTLE BACK BOOK #1; and SUICIDE SQUAD (vol. 4) #4.
